Output 5dc84760d729a24efb1f230384aa1b88f75602aed10f73aaf013e83b1b32ae57:1

value
49500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d8d817c28564efbaa63222f8090ff5887e612d4 OP_EQUALVERIFY OP_CHECKSIG
address
16cTjhRuLKpEug5Bj1WQ9Eo7qtkAzT3bvz
transaction
5dc84760d729a24efb1f230384aa1b88f75602aed10f73aaf013e83b1b32ae57
spent
true